The Boughs Of Holly Designer Paper is so pretty; it can be used to make Christmas cards in a jiffy. You can see all of the patterns by clicking on its picture in my Product List below.
I began today’s card with an Evening Evergreen card base, 8 1/2″ X 5 1/2″, folded at 4 1/4″. It was layered with Basic White Cardstock, 4″ X 5 1/4″, and Boughs Of Holly Designer Paper, cut 1/8″ smaller, giving it a 1/16″ white border. Then, I cut a horizontal piece of Boughs Of Holly Designer Paper, 4″ X 2″, and glued it in place.

Joy & Peace
The sentiment took a little extra time, because I decided to heat emboss it. “Joy & Peace” is from the Leaves Of Holly Stamp Set, stamped in VersaMark on Evening Evergreen Cardstock. Then, I sprinkled it with White Embossing Powder. After it was set with the Heat Tool, I used the second smallest, square, Stylish Shapes Die for cutting. Lastly, I glued the square sentiment to a Wonderful Snowflake, and attached it with Dimensionals.
The snowflakes have an iridescent shine, which isn’t showing in the photo, come 24 in a pack, and very handy to use.

For the final touch, I added three Iridescent Pearl Basic Jewels, mimicking the red dots in the Boughs Of Holly Designer Paper. The white pearls were made red by coloring them with a Real Red Stampin’ Blend.

Today’s card is “clean & simple,” using the Full Of Love Stamp Set. I began by stamping the envelope full of flowers in Memento Black Ink on Basic White Cardstock, and using my Paper Snips for cutting.

Flower-filled Envelope
After cutting, I colored the bouquet with three colors of Stampin’ Blends: Pumpkin Pie, Highland Heather, and Granny Apple Green. Then, I placed the flower-filled envelope on Dimensionals.

The background is Basic White Cardstock (5 1/4″ X 4″) stamped across the middle with Memento Black Ink. I found the detailed pattern in the Daffodil Daydream Stamp Set, and used my Stamparatus for placement. While the layer was in the Stamparatus, I stamped the sentiment, also in Memento Black Ink. “Always grateful for you” is one of three sentiments in the Full Of Love Stamp Set. You can see the entire set in my Product List below.
After gluing the layer to a Gorgeous Grape card base, 8 1/2″ X 5 1/2″, folded at 4 1/4″, my “clean & simple” card was complete.

I was playing with the Happy Forest Friends Designer Paper over the weekend, when Brown Bear, Red Fox, and Golden Owl said it was about time I used the stamps!

Forest Friends
My forest friends heard that the Pals Blog Hop was a color challenge, and thought they were the perfect colors. Brown Bear said to stamp him in Crumb Cake Ink, Red Fox said Cajun Craze, of course, and Golden Owl claimed Mango Melody.

After using their stamps from the Happier Than Happy Stamp Set, they asked me to cut them free from the Basic White Cardstock using their Happy Forest Dies. Plus, Golden Owl said she needed a perch, so I stamped a tree stump in Crumb Cake Ink, and used its die for cutting. This made her very happy.

The fourth color in the challenge was Mossy Meadow, and just right for a forest background. First, I cut Basic White Cardstock with the largest Deckled Rectangles Die, and embossed it with the Leaf Fall Embossing Folder. Then, I used a Blending Brush and Mossy Meadow Ink for coloring. This layer was glued to a Mossy Meadow card base, 8 1/2″ X 5 1/2″, folded at 4 1/4″. The forest friends were delighted that I made them feel at home.

Brown Bear said he wanted to welcome everyone to their forest! For the sentiment, he said I should stamp “welcome” from their stamp set in Mossy Meadow Ink, and use a Happy Forest Die for cutting. He even suggested I tie it to his paw with Linen Thread, which I thought was a great idea.
Suddenly, Golden Owl said their card needed one more thing. She flew off, and came back with a Fine Sparkle Gem, which she placed on the welcome tag. She declared the card was complete, now that a gem matched her beautiful Mango Melody feathers.

I happen to know that gnomes love gardens in the Fall. Today’s card began by embossing Basic White Cardstock, 4″ X 5 1/4,” with the Leaf Fall Embossing Folder. After embossing, I used a Blending Brush to apply a gorgeous, Fall color, Crushed Curry. This layer was glued to a Thick Basic White card base, 8 1/2″ X 5 1/2″, folded at 4 1/4″.

Fall Gnome
Next, it was time for the gnome to appear. I used Gnome Dies to cut his Basic White beard, Basic Black pants and shoes, Gingham Cottage Designer Paper hat in Pumpkin Pie, and his nose, colored with an Ivory Stampin’ Blend. I glued the four pieces together with a tiny amount of glue, and attached him with Dimensionals.

The gnome wanted to say a big “HELLO,” which I found in the Hello Harvest Stamp Set. I stamped it in Memento Black Ink, used a Harvest Die for cutting, and attached it with Dimensionals. The gnome didn’t mind that I added a Gingham Ribbon bow to his hat, because it matched his outfit. Also, I made it thinner by cutting the ribbon in half, which he thought was important.

The slimline design was easily accomplished with a Thick Basic White card base, 8 1/2″ X 7″, folded at 3 1/2″. Then I added a layer of Basic White Cardstock, 8 1/4″ X 3 1/4″.
Next, using a Happy Forrest Die, I cut trees from five colors of Cardstock: Tahitian Tide, Parakeet Party, Daffodil Delight, Pale Papaya, and Flirty Flamingo.

“Oh, Christmas tree”
After cutting the trees, I used a Trees For Sale stamp to stamp trees in the same ink colors across the white layer. Before gluing the die-cut trees next to the stamped trees, I flicked a Black Stampin’ Blend brush against the lid to add a spray of dots.

The sentiment, “Christmas Greetings,” is from the Trees For Sale Stamp Set. I stamped it in Memento Black Ink on Basic White Cardstock, fussy cut, and attached it with Dimensionals. The last detail was stamping stars from the Trees For Sale Stamp Set in Memento Black Ink.

The Full Of Love Stamp Set has wonderful images of flowers and envelopes. This is a perfect set for card makers, because we love sending cards in envelopes! Because it’s Fall, for today’s card, I used Stampin’ Blends to color the bouquet in Fall colors: Pumpkin Pie, Old Olive, Cajun Craze, Calypso Coral, and Daffodil Delight. If you look closely, you’ll see some white spaces, which was intentional. Sometimes it’s nice to give “breathing space.”
After coloring the image on Basic White Cardstock, I used the largest, plain, Layering Circles Die for cutting. Then, I used the largest, scalloped, Layering Circles Die to cut Basic Black Cardstock, glued the two together, and placed it on Dimensionals.

Full Of Love
Next, I cut a piece of Vellum Layering Designs, 4″ X 5 1/4″, and glued it to a Thick Basic White card base, 8 1/2″ X 5 1/2″, folded at 4 1/4″. This vellum has white script, for a subtle tie-in with the envelope.
The strip behind the circle is Cottage Gingham Designer Paper, 4″ X 2 1/4″.

The sentiment is from the Full Of Love Stamp Set, stamped in Memento Black Ink on Basic White Cardstock. After stamping, I used a Sending Die for cutting, and attached it with Dimensionals.
Finally, I stamped a single flower, which I fussy cut, colored it with Stampin’ Blends, and attached it with a Dimensional.
